Linux-ordlista: definitionerna som hjälper dig att bättre förstå den här världen

Linux-ordlista

Med varje nytt år som kommer, eller dagar innan det som nu, läses ofta artiklar som försäkrar att detta kommer att bli Linux-året. Jag har läst den i mycket mer än ett decennium, men året med system som de vi diskuterar i den här bloggen har ännu inte kommit. Dels är det logiskt: Windows finns överallt, och det är mycket att skylla på att det är installerat som standard på vilken dator som helst. Av denna anledning vet många av er inte vad vissa ord som vi använder i den här världen betyder, och det är anledningen till att vi har tänkt att publicera den här artikeln som en Linux ordlista.

Det är nästan säkert att vi i framtiden kommer att skriva fler artiklar som förklarar mer i detalj vad som nämns i denna Linux-ordlista, men vad vi vill göra i den här artikeln är just det, en Linux-ordlista, som inte är något annat än en ordlista med en definition som är tänkt att vara tydlig, kort och koncis. Vi kommer att placera dem i alfabetisk ordning, och vi kommer säkert att uppdatera det med fler definitioner i framtiden, oavsett om vi har något annat att lägga till eller våra läsare föreslår det.

Linux-ordlista: Definitioner som alla borde känna till

  • SOM EN: akronym för Avancerad Linux-ljudarkitektur och är ett ramverk för programvara och en del av Linux-kärnan som tillhandahåller ett applikationsprogrammeringsgränssnitt (API) för ljudkortsdrivrutiner.
  • AppImage: format för att distribuera "bärbar" programvara på Linux utan att behöva vara en superanvändare för att installera applikationen, något som den faktiskt inte gör. De är ett paket där huvudprogramvara och beroenden ingår i samma körbara fil. Relaterad artikel.
  • Bash: UNIX-liknande skal och kommandospråk
  • CLI: Förkortning för "Command Line Interface". Det används till exempel när ett program fungerar i terminalen och dess gränssnitt inte är grafiskt. Exempel.
  • kommandot: text som är skriven i en terminal, skript och andra delar för att utlösa åtgärder. Vi skulle också kunna hänvisa till dem som "ordning".
  • distro: Förkortat ord för "distribution" som i grunden definierar ett "root" eller "källa" operativsystem baserat på Linux, som Debian, Ubuntu eller Red Hat. Från dem kommer "smakerna" eller "smakerna": Ubuntu är distribution, Kubuntu är smak. Även om enligt vissa användare eller en annan definition skulle operativsystemet vara basen och det som kommer ut från dem skulle vara distributionen. Till exempel: Arch Linux: operativsystem; Manjaro, distro.
  • Grafisk miljö- Även känd som "skrivbordsmiljön" i vissa länder, är det en grupp komponenter som tillhandahåller användargränssnittselement som ikoner, verktygsfält, bakgrundsbilder och widgets. Tack vare den grafiska miljön kan vi använda Linux grafiskt med mus och tangentbord som vi gör i Windows och macOS. Bland de mest kända har vi GNOME, Plasma eller XFCE.
  • Flatpak: pakethanteringsverktyg med vilket programvara distribueras, installeras och hanteras som inkluderar, i samma paket, huvudmjukvaran, beroenden, körtid och allt som behövs för att få det att fungera på alla Linux-baserade system som har eller läggs till det medium. De är universella paket och sandlåda (isolerade). Det mest använda arkivet är Flathub.
  • GNU: akronym för "GNU's Not Unix", och huvudansvarig var Richard Stallman på 80-talet. Linux-baserade operativsystem är faktiskt GNU/Linux, även om vi i alla medier förkortar (dåliga) och refererar direkt till dem som "Linux" .
  • GRUB: GNU Grand Unified Boot loader o GRUB är ett program som gör det möjligt för användaren att välja vilket operativsystem som är installerat eller vilken kärna som ska laddas vid tidpunkten för systemstart. Det tillåter också användaren att skicka argument till kärnan. Man kan säga att det är startprogrammet som används i Linux.
  • GUI: akronym för "Graphical User Interface", vilket är ett grafiskt användargränssnitt som låter oss interagera med programvaran genom fönster, kryssrutor, knappar, etc. Det är som fönstret vi ser när vi kör programvara. Utan GUI, vad vi skulle ha är programvara i "CLI", som vi har förklarat ovan.
  • jack: akronym för "JACK Audio Connection Kit", vilket är en ljudserver (och något annat) som låter ljudet ljuda när applikationerna ber om det. Det är inte den enda som finns i Linux.
  • Kärna: kärnan. Hjärtat. När vi talar om ett "Linux" operativsystem (väl sagt att det skulle vara "GNU / Linux"), är det vi säger att det använder Linuxkärnan, som är det första lagret av programvaran som används i dessa system och att det innehåller utöver allt drivrutiner så att det fungerar i vilket hårdvaruteam som helst. Det var faktiskt Linus Torvalds avsikt när han startade det som ett karriärprojekt som han fortsätter att arbeta med.
  • LTS: Förkortning för "Långsiktigt stöd". Det används för att indikera att ett operativsystem eller program kommer att stödjas under en längre tid, och är där det ses mest i LTS-versionerna av Ubuntu som kommer ut vartannat år och stöds i 5.
  • Live session: "livesessionerna" är de som finns så länge vi inte stänger av eller startar om datorn. Alla ändringar vi gjort kommer att förstöras vid den tidpunkten. De används ofta på en USB för att installera ett operativsystem eller som ett återställningsverktyg.
  • PipeWire: är en server för att hantera ljud- och videoströmmar och hårdvara i Linux. Hanterar multimediarouting och pipelinebearbetning. När denna artikel skrevs, i december 2021, är den fortfarande under utveckling, men det förväntas att den, tillsammans med Wayland, kommer att avsevärt förbättra allt relaterat till bild och ljud, och även förbättra kompatibiliteten mellan de olika ljudservrarna och video..
  • Puls- Nätverkskompatibel ljudserver som används främst på Linux, men även på BSD-, macOS- eller Solaris-system.
  • Release Candidate- Etikett eller ord som används för att referera till en avancerad version av programvara som är under utveckling. Det finns till exempel företag som märker sin programvara som "Release Candidate" en vecka eller två innan den stabila versionen släpps. När det gäller kärnan (Linux) används den i två månader, men eftersom det de faktiskt gör är förändringar över den stabila versionen.
  • Rullande släpp– Mjukvaruutveckling och leveransmodell som kommer så fort den är tillgänglig, och operativsystemen som använder den installeras en gång och får uppdateringar för livet. I Linux är Arch Linux, och man trodde att Windows 10 skulle vara när de försäkrade att det skulle bli den senaste versionen av Microsofts system (nu är det känt att det kommer att finnas Windows 11). Även om, ja, Windows uppfyllde bara delen av uppdatering för livet, och inte ens det.
  • Shell: Linux-kommando eller kommandotolk.
  • su: kommando vars betydelse är "ersättande användare", och används huvudsakligen för att byta från en användare till en annan. Den gör detta genom att starta ett inloggningsskal i den aktuella katalogen och miljön (su) eller genom att växla helt till målanvändarinställningarna (su -).
  • sudo: kommando för att begära förhöjda eller superanvändarprivilegier. Det ställs vanligtvis framför andra kommandon för att kunna utföra vissa åtgärder, som att installera programvara eller flytta filer till skyddade kataloger. Artikel om sudo och su.
  • snap: pakethanterare och utveckling utvecklad av Canonical och som konkurrerar med Flatpak för att vara universella paket som inkluderar programvara och beroenden, körtider och annat i samma paket. De är också sandlåda. Relaterad artikel.
  • Vingla: fönsterhanteraren efterträdare till i3 som är tillgängligt på Linux-baserade operativsystem. Den är designad för att fungera i Wayland och har inget skrivbord att använda. Fönstren öppnas i helskärm, med konfigurerbara marginaler, de nya fönstren delar upp skärmen automatiskt och du kan enkelt byta från ett "skrivbord" till ett annat med kortkommandon. Faktum är att en erfaren användare kan göra allt med tangentbordet. Eftersom den inte har många komponenter i en normal grafisk miljö är den lättare.
  • symlink: "symboliska" eller "mjuka" länkar, som i andra system är kända som "genvägar". De kan till exempel användas för att komma åt en fil eller mapp från en annan sökväg. Relaterad länk.
  • tarball: mycket programvara distribueras komprimerad. Ett allmänt använt format för detta är TAR, från Tape Archive, och tarballen eller tarfilen är namnet på en grupp eller fil som består av fler filer som sammanfogas med hjälp av TAR-kommandot eller ett grafiskt gränssnitt (GUI) komprimeringsprogram. De kan hittas med tillägget .tar eller .tar.gz, och programvaran kan installeras direkt från tarballen.
  • terminal: kringutrustning som interagerar med människan, består av utdata och input, en skärm och ett tangentbord. Det vi använder i Linux när vi är på ett system med ett grafiskt gränssnitt är faktiskt en "terminalemulator".
  • Tux: Linux-maskot. Det är en pingvin och förekommer i mjukvara som Tux Guitar, Tux Paint eller Tux Kart. Relaterad artikel.
  • Wayland: visningsprotokoll med extra säkerhetslager. Varje app betraktas som en klient och hårdvaran är en server, och Wayland skulle vara bryggan som gör bilden möjlig. Idag fokuserar många utvecklare på Wayland eftersom det är det bästa alternativet och framtiden ligger i det.
  • VIN: akronym för Wine Is Not an Emulator, men i verkligheten verkar det som att det är det. Det är mjukvara som innehåller allt du behöver för att köra Windows-applikationer på Linux, men även på macOS och till och med Android. I ständig utveckling och förbättring över tid kan den installeras t.ex. Guitar Pro på Linux.
  • X11: X Window (även känt som X11, eller bara X) är ett klient-/serverfönstersystem för bitmappsvisningar. Det är implementerat på de flesta UNIX-liknande operativsystem och har porterats till många andra system.

Något mer att tillägga?

Den här artikeln om Linux-ordlistan kommer att uppdateras med tiden att inkludera fler och fler definitioner. Först lade vi till dessa eftersom vi vet att många av er tvivlar på dem, till exempel "tarball". Vår avsikt är att hjälpa dig att förstå, och vi hoppas att efter att ha läst denna Linux-ordlista kommer det att bli lättare att läsa andra artiklar på bloggen.


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för data: AB Internet Networks 2008 SL
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.

  1.   Noel sade

    Något som förvirrar mig är sudo vs su, och välsignad grub som är skadad